From b95eebec653c749cbc2c2b3932d5b075d566e9b5 Mon Sep 17 00:00:00 2001 From: Alexander Ried Date: Tue, 3 May 2016 20:03:14 +0200 Subject: connman: 1.31 -> 1.32 fetch release tarball instead of git checkout and drop autotools This update is compatible with iptables 1.6.0 (see #12178) --- pkgs/tools/networking/connman/default.nix | 26 +++++++++++++------------- 1 file changed, 13 insertions(+), 13 deletions(-) (limited to 'pkgs/tools/networking') diff --git a/pkgs/tools/networking/connman/default.nix b/pkgs/tools/networking/connman/default.nix index 7af692f782e8..f8abdb33d9d6 100644 --- a/pkgs/tools/networking/connman/default.nix +++ b/pkgs/tools/networking/connman/default.nix @@ -1,26 +1,25 @@ -{ stdenv, fetchgit, autoconf, automake, libtool, pkgconfig, openconnect, file, +{ stdenv, fetchurl, pkgconfig, openconnect, file, openvpn, vpnc, glib, dbus, iptables, gnutls, polkit, - wpa_supplicant, readline6, pptp, ppp, tree }: + wpa_supplicant, readline6, pptp, ppp }: stdenv.mkDerivation rec { name = "connman-${version}"; - version = "1.31"; - src = fetchgit { - url = "git://git.kernel.org/pub/scm/network/connman/connman.git"; - rev = "refs/tags/${version}"; - sha256 = "90dab6b11841cb4b6400711d234b59fb4fad4e8778bed6e7ad3ac7ac135d6893"; + version = "1.32"; + src = fetchurl { + url = "mirror://kernel/linux/network/connman/${name}.tar.xz"; + sha256 = "0k4kw2j78gwxf0rq79a099qkzl6wi4v5i7rfs4rn0si0fd68d19i"; }; - buildInputs = [ autoconf automake libtool pkgconfig openconnect polkit - file openvpn vpnc glib dbus iptables gnutls - wpa_supplicant readline6 pptp ppp tree ]; + buildInputs = [ openconnect polkit + openvpn vpnc glib dbus iptables gnutls + wpa_supplicant readline6 pptp ppp ]; + + nativeBuildInputs = [ pkgconfig file ]; preConfigure = '' export WPASUPPLICANT=${wpa_supplicant}/sbin/wpa_supplicant - ./bootstrap + export PPPD=${ppp}/sbin/pppd sed -i "s/\/usr\/bin\/file/file/g" ./configure - substituteInPlace configure --replace /usr/sbin/pptp ${pptp}/sbin/pptp - substituteInPlace configure --replace /usr/sbin/pppd ${ppp}/sbin/pppd ''; configureFlags = [ @@ -43,6 +42,7 @@ stdenv.mkDerivation rec { "--enable-tools" "--enable-datafiles" "--enable-pptp" + "--with-pptp=${pptp}/sbin/pptp" ]; postInstall = '' -- cgit 1.4.1 From d74335da85c33ef9d0539a94cd9e0f209cb7ff98 Mon Sep 17 00:00:00 2001 From: Alexander Ried Date: Tue, 3 May 2016 20:05:57 +0200 Subject: connman: make dependency on awk explicit --- pkgs/tools/networking/connman/default.nix |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'pkgs/tools/networking') diff --git a/pkgs/tools/networking/connman/default.nix b/pkgs/tools/networking/connman/default.nix index f8abdb33d9d6..c9380761f9fa 100644 --- a/pkgs/tools/networking/connman/default.nix +++ b/pkgs/tools/networking/connman/default.nix @@ -1,4 +1,4 @@ -{ stdenv, fetchurl, pkgconfig, openconnect, file, +{ stdenv, fetchurl, pkgconfig, openconnect, file, gawk, openvpn, vpnc, glib, dbus, iptables, gnutls, polkit, wpa_supplicant, readline6, pptp, ppp }: @@ -14,11 +14,12 @@ stdenv.mkDerivation rec { openvpn vpnc glib dbus iptables gnutls wpa_supplicant readline6 pptp ppp ]; - nativeBuildInputs = [ pkgconfig file ]; + nativeBuildInputs = [ pkgconfig file gawk ]; preConfigure = '' export WPASUPPLICANT=${wpa_supplicant}/sbin/wpa_supplicant export PPPD=${ppp}/sbin/pppd + export AWK=${gawk}/bin/gawk sed -i "s/\/usr\/bin\/file/file/g" ./configure ''; -- cgit 1.4.1